    Comprehending the IELTS Test

    The IELTS test measures English language proficiency throughout four main locations: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. The test is created for individuals preparing to study, work, or migrate to English-speaking nations. It provides a trusted assessment of a candidate’s capability to interact effectively in English.

    Kinds of IELTS

    There are 2 types of IELTS tests:

    1. IELTS Academic: This test is planned for people looking for greater education or expert registration in an English-speaking environment.
    2. IELTS General Training: This variation is created for those planning to carry out non-academic training or work experience, or for migration functions.

    Significance of IELTS in Uzbekistan

    In Uzbekistan, the efficiency of English has ended up being progressively important, specifically as the nation incorporates into the worldwide economy. Here are some crucial reasons acquiring a registered IELTS certificate is considerable for individuals in Uzbekistan:

    1. Educational Opportunities: Many universities in Western countries need IELTS scores for admission. A signed up IELTS certificate opens doors to college abroad.
    2. Work Prospects: Numerous worldwide business operating in Uzbekistan prefer or need prospects to possess an acknowledged level of English efficiency.
    3. Immigration Requirements: Countries like Canada, Australia, and the UK need IELTS scores for visa applications.
    4. Expert Licensing: Certain professions, particularly in healthcare, require evidence of English proficiency, making IELTS vital for career advancement.

    IELTS Test Structure

    The IELTS test includes four parts, each designed to assess different language abilities. The overall test time is around 2 hours and 45 minutes.

    Part
    Duration
    Description

    Listening
    Thirty minutes
    Four recorded monologues and conversations

    Checking out
    60 minutes
    Academic or General Training texts

    Writing
    60 minutes
    2 jobs: report writing and essay

    Speaking
    11-14 minutes
    A face-to-face interview with an inspector

    Preparing for the IELTS Exam

    Though the IELTS test can be difficult, correct preparation can substantially enhance a candidate’s possibilities of accomplishing a desirable rating. Here’s a list of reliable preparation strategies:

    1. Take a Diagnostic Test: Assess your present English proficiency to identify areas for enhancement.
    2. Register in IELTS Preparation Courses: Many language schools in Uzbekistan provide courses customized for IELTS preparation.
    3. Practice Regularly: Utilize practice tests and products available online and in libraries.
    4. Familiarize Yourself with the Test Format: Understanding the structure and timing of the test can assist ease anxiety on exam day.
    5. Take Part In English Conversations: Practice speaking with buddies, language exchange partners, or tutors.
    6. Usage IELTS Preparation Books: Invest in credible IELTS preparation books to strengthen your learning.
